Position Purpose
The IT Audit Officer will conduct audits to assess the effectiveness of IT systems, identify risks and weaknesses, and ensure system integrity, security, and efficiency in line with relevant standards and regulations.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ist the Manager Internal Audit in developing and executing risk-based audit plans
- Evaluate IT systems, applications, and infrastructure for compliance with regulatory requirements and internal policies
- Prepare detailed audit reports with findings, recommendations, and action plans
- Collaborate with IT and business teams to address audit issues and implement improvements
- Conduct follow-up reviews to ensure corrective actions are effectively implemented
- Stay updated on emerging IT audit trends, technologies, and best practices
- Maintain audit documentation including working papers and evidence
- Support delivery of IT-related training and awareness within the organisation
Required Skills, Knowledge and Experience
- Bachelor’s degree in IT, Computer Science, Information Systems, or a related field
- Professional certification such as CISA or equivalent is an advantage
- Minimum of 3–5 years’ experience in IT audit
- Strong understanding of banking systems, databases, cybersecurity, and governance frameworks (COBIT, ITIL, NIST)
- Excellent analytical, communication, and problem-solving skills
- Proficiency in data analysis tools and technologies
- Ability to build positive working relationships across all levels
- Capable of working independently and meeting deadlines
